Syntakt, Hydrasynth midi control fun !

I’m controlling ST Velocity and Note values with CCs, so everything is perfectly synced.
No arp.

10 Likes

What you are saying is even if you’re not tight, the Notes ‘‘snap’’ to the Grid in 1/16 ?

Yep, because notes are already sequenced by ST with red trigs.
But velocity is set to 1, and their Note value is track’s default.

So I send Velocity CC4 127 to make the note earable, and Note CC3 keytracked by Hydrasynth mod matrix. You can do it with your HS and any Digi…:wink:
